TS REBEL staff are all volunteers (aged 18-65) with a wide range of skills, experience and qualifications. We are particularly looking to recruit people who:

  • Have teaching qualifications and/or experience of working with young people.
  • Are enthusiastic to promote the ethos and objectives of the Sea cadet Corps in a practical environment.
  • Have good people skills.
In addition:
  • Have RYA Day Skipper Practical certificate to act as offshore “first mates” or keel boat skippers.
  • Have RYA Yachtmaster Offshore qualification to act as offshore skippers.
  • Have RYA Dinghy Instructor qualification to act as keel boat instructors.
  • Have RYA Power Boat Instructor qualification to act as instructors to Levels 1 and 2 (displacement).
  • Have RYA Power Boat Level 2 (Coastal) to act as power boat coxn’s for support operations.
We would also like to hear from anybody capable of cooking for up to 15 people at a time on some of our 20 odd shorebased weekends each year.

Staff, either uniformed or civilian, are expected to a commit to a number of weekends and one week each year.

TS REBEL provides a great opportunity for staff to develop their boating skills and further their qualifications. Applicants should have reasonable access to Walton on the Naze in Essex where most of the training is carried out. All applicants are subject to a CRB Full Disclosure check.
